High-Performance CNC The 8065 CNC is equipped with advanced features necessary for high-speed ma- chining, while maintaining the best machining surface finish and providing maximum ac- curacy. Features include up to 28 axes and four execution channels and four spindles, volumetric compensation capability, and adaptive real-
time feed and speed control. Also included are high-speed surface accuracy, IIP programming (ICON key utilization), Ethernet, USB, built-in touch-sensitive mouse pad, and ISO G-code programming format. FAGOR Automation Ph: 800-423-2467 Web site: www.faborautomation.com
Economical Entry CMM The Spectrum CMM is a bridge- types machine designed for gen- eral measurement with the RDS-C5 articulating probe holder and XDT multi-point senor or Renishaw TP20 touch-trigger probe, enabling the CMM to measure angled
features in difficult-to-reach locations. The articulating probe holder offers ±180° of bidirectional rotation and permits indexing steps of 5° reaching 5184 angular positions for either sensor. Spectrum models offer X,Y,Z measuring ranges from 700 × 700 × 600 mm to 700 × 1000 × 600 mm. The machine’s accuracy of up to MPEe 2.1 + L/250 is guaranteed over a tempera- ture range from 18 to 22° C. Spectrum is available with Calypso CAD-based software with Visual Metrology.
